A gradual decrease in temperature is expected in Ukraine from January 5. The peak of cooling will fall on the 6th-9th. In particular, precipitation will fall and severe frosts will hit. Forecaster Natalia Didenko warned about this.
So, according to her forecast, relatively warm weather will prevail in Ukraine on January 4. The maximum air temperature tomorrow will be +2…+8 degrees in most regions, up to +5…+11 degrees in the south and west. No precipitation.
“In the future, the air temperature will decrease, the peak of the decrease will fall on January 6-9, precipitation will first appear in the form of rain, then turn into sleet and snow,” the forecaster predicts.
According to her, the coldest Christmas days and nights will be the north, the part of the center closer to the east, and the east of Ukraine. It will probably be -10…-16 degrees there at night.
“That’s why, for now, you just need to carefully monitor updated forecasts and prepare for a sudden change in the weather,” she said.
According to the Ukrainian Hydrometeorological Center, the weather is expected to worsen in Ukraine this year. According to forecasts of forecasters, from Thursday, January 5, precipitation of different phases is expected almost throughout the country, and the temperature will begin to gradually decrease.
So, in the western, northern, most of the central and Kharkiv regions, wet snow is expected at night, during the day – mainly rain, with wet snow and ice sticking in places.
